Def Jam x adidas Superstar II – 25th Anniversary Collection – Redman

Though Def Jam has had adidas create some shoes to honor their success and 25th anniversary, the record label powerhouse has also produced some to pay respect to some of their staple artists who have not only help build the company itself, but have created legendary names of their own.  Here an adidas Superstar II for the likes of Def Jam’s funny man and super MC, Redman.  Featuring a rather vibrant red suede upper and speckled sole, the shoe design is made to resemble his breakthrough album, “Whut? Thee Album.”  Additionally, a portrait of is found on the tongue, and the typical branding on the back of the midsole and the heel tab is respectively replaced with “Redman” and his other moniker, “Funk Doc.”  To top things off, the pair comes with a second pair of infrared type colored laces, just in case the radiance of the upper itself wasn’t loud enough.  Along with these Superstars, adidas has also manufactured a tshirt that also features Def Jam and Redman branding, as well as nods to his album.  Executing just as hard as one of Redman’s punchlines, these can be found at select adidas retailers like Extra Butter.
